auto NetRequest::handleRedirect() -> bool
{
    QUrl redirect = m_reply->header(QNetworkRequest::LocationHeader).toUrl();
    if (!redirect.isValid()) {
        if (!m_reply->hasRawHeader("Location")) {
            // no redirect -> it's fine to continue
            return false;
        }
        // there is a Location header, but it's not correct. we need to apply some workarounds...
        QByteArray redirectBA = m_reply->rawHeader("Location");
        if (redirectBA.size() == 0) {
            // empty, yet present redirect header? WTF?
            return false;
        }
        QString redirectStr = QString::fromUtf8(redirectBA);

        if (redirectStr.startsWith("//")) {
            /*
             * IF the URL begins with //, we need to insert the URL scheme.
             * See: https://bugreports.qt.io/browse/QTBUG-41061
             * See: http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c3986#section-4.2
             */
            redirectStr = m_reply->url().scheme() + ":" + redirectStr;
        } else if (redirectStr.startsWith("/")) {
            /*
             * IF the URL begins with /, we need to process it as a relative URL
             */
            auto url = m_reply->url();
            url.setPath(redirectStr, QUrl::TolerantMode);
            redirectStr = url.toString();
        }

        /*
         * Next, make sure the URL is parsed in tolerant mode. Qt doesn't parse the location header in tolerant mode, which causes issues.
         * FIXME: report Qt bug for this
         */
        redirect = QUrl(redirectStr, QUrl::TolerantMode);
        if (!redirect.isValid()) {
            qCWarning(logCat) << getUid().toString() << "Failed to parse redirect URL:" << redirectStr;
            downloadError(QNetworkReply::ProtocolFailure);
            return false;
        }
        qCDebug(logCat) << getUid().toString() << "Fixed location header:" << redirect;
    } else {
        qCDebug(logCat) << getUid().toString() << "Location header:" << redirect;
    }

    m_url = QUrl(redirect.toString());
    qCDebug(logCat) << getUid().toString() << "Following redirect to " << m_url.toString();
    startAction(m_network);

    return true;
}
